1. What is Nandrolone Decanoate?

Nandrolone Decanoate is a synthetic anabolic steroid derivative of testosterone. It enhances protein synthesis and increases nitrogen retention in the muscles, making it particularly effective for building muscle mass and strength.

2. Benefits of Nandrolone Decanoate

  1. Muscle Growth: Nandrolone is known for its ability to promote lean muscle mass and increase strength.
  2. Recovery Enhancement: The steroid aids in quicker recovery from intense workouts by reducing muscle soreness and damage.
  3. Improved Bone Density: It can also improve bone density and reduce the risk of osteoporosis.
  4. Less Estrogenic Activity: Nandrolone has a lower conversion rate to estrogen compared to other anabolic steroids, reducing the risk of side effects like gynecomastia.

4. Potential Side Effects

While Nandrolone Decanoate has its benefits, it’s essential to be aware of potential side effects, including:

  • Acne and oily skin
  • Increased hair growth or hair loss
  • Changes in libido
  • Cardiovascular issues with prolonged use
